Core Features and Functions of AI in Electronics Contract Manufacturing
AI technologies, such as machine learning, computer vision, and predictive analytics, play pivotal roles in electronics contract manufacturing. By leveraging vast datasets, AI algorithms can optimize manufacturing processes, predict equipment failures, and automate quality control. Key features include:
- Automated Inspection: AI-driven computer vision systems can swiftly assess the quality of manufactured components, identifying defects far more reliably than human inspectors.
- Predictive Maintenance: AI systems can analyze real-time data from machinery to predict when maintenance should occur, significantly reducing downtime and increasing operational efficiency.
- Supply Chain Optimization: AI algorithms can enhance inventory management and logistics by forecasting demand and optimizing stock levels, ensuring that production lines operate smoothly without bottlenecks.
Advantages and Application Scenarios for AI in Electronics Contract Manufacturing
Adopting AI in electronics contract manufacturing provides multiple advantages:
- Enhanced Efficiency: With automated processes and predictive maintenance, manufacturers can streamline operations, ultimately reducing time-to-market for new products.
- Improved Quality Assurance: Consistent and highly accurate inspections minimize defects, resulting in higher-quality products and increased customer satisfaction.
- Cost Reduction: By optimizing operations and reducing waste through AI insights, manufacturers can lower production costs, creating room for competitive pricing.
Real-world applications of AI in this field include the assembly of consumer electronics, automotive parts, and telecommunications equipment. For example, companies can employ AI-enhanced inspection systems during the assembly of circuit boards to ensure precision and quality.

Electronics contract manufacturers adopting AI technologies have observed remarkable improvements in their operations. A leading electronics contract manufacturer in the automotive sector recently integrated AI-based quality control systems and reported a 30% decrease in defective products. Feedback from operations managers highlights not only the reduction in defects but also the improvement in employee efficiency and morale, as staff can focus on more strategic tasks rather than routine inspections.
Another example is a telecommunications manufacturer that implemented predictive maintenance solutions driven by AI algorithms. This resulted in a significant reduction in machine downtime, leading to increased production rates and lower operational costs. These case studies underscore the transformative power of AI in real-world manufacturing scenarios.
